Door of Destinies vs Radiant Destiny — MTG Card Comparison
Door of Destinies
As this artifact enters, choose a creature type.
Whenever you cast a spell of the chosen type, put a charge counter on this artifact.
Creatures you control of the chosen type get +1/+1 for each charge counter on this artifact.
Radiant Destiny
Ascend (If you control ten or more permanents, you get the city's blessing for the rest of the game.)
As this enchantment enters, choose a creature type.
Creatures you control of the chosen type get +1/+1. As long as you have the city's blessing, they also have vigilance.
